How to Pick the Right Splashback Tile?
Colour Coordination
Match or contrast your cabinetry and benchtops for balance. White kitchen splashback tiles are ideal for darker cabinetry, while black or grey tiles add drama to lighter palettes.
Gloss vs Matte
- Gloss tiles reflect light and are easier to wipe clean
- Matte tiles offer a more understated, modern look
Tile Size Guidelines
- Small kitchens often suit subway tiles kitchen splashback, or mosaics
- For larger spaces or minimal grout lines, go for large tiles for the kitchen splashback
Cooktop Width |
Recommended Tile Size |
600mm |
75x150mm or 100x300mm |
900mm |
200x600mm or larger |
1200mm |
Slab Look or Large Format Tiles |
Grout Tips
Choose a grout colour that complements the tile: light for seamless looks, darker for contrast. Use sealed or epoxy grout for easier cleaning.
